  • Washington: This family is the one belonging to Anthony Robert Washington, the founder of the Bloodsuckers Local 76 union, and almost every member of the family is a member of the union as well. It's a highly egalitarian family, and also the one with probably the most connections with the mortal workforce. They're a go to group for people coming into the city from overseas who need large quantities of things brought safely into the country, particularly in cases where people don't want the authorities looking closely at what's being shipped through the port. They allow members of any clan, but require BL76 membership as a requirement for adoption for those who are young enough, and outward support of the union for those who are too old. The family controls the Port of Philadelphia.
  • Touati: The founder of this family, Shiri Touati, is also the Gangrel clan head. They are well connected in social circles both in mortal society and kindred as an arts patron and community organizer. Their family is a small one, but has the distinction of being the family with the largest number of direct descendants of the family's founder in a city where permission for the embrace is strictly controlled. A good number of the city's Gangrel who don't feel like they fit the stereotypes of their clan also find their way to the Touati family, but it also contains one or two members of each of the other clans as well. The family controls the Avenue of Arts, a point of significant contention with more than one of the Daeva families.
